サイトアイコン WEB帳

GoogleアナリティクスでPDFなどのファイルのダウンロード数を測定する方法(ユニバーサルアナリティクス対応)

ユニバーサルアナリティクスになってから初の試みという事で、イベントトラッキングをお浚いしました。

イベントトラッキングを使う場面

とりあえず、思いつくもイベントトラッキングを使う場面を書き出しました。

イベントトラッキングコード

イベントトラッキングコードは、通常のaタグのリンクにonClickを下記のように追記するだけです。

イベントトラッキングのサンプル

<a href="リンク先URL" onClick="ga('send', 'event', 'link', 'click', 'label');">外部リンク</a>

ga()内の各項目の簡単な説明は、下記の通りです。

サンプル名 名称 説明
send 固定部分(必須 ga(‘send’, ‘event’は固定部分
event
link カテゴリ(必須 任意の名前(例:download、link、banner)
click アクション(必須 任意の名前(例:click、pdf)
label ラベル(推奨オプション) 任意の名前(※レポートのイベントラベルで表示される名前)
数値 値(オプション) ダウンロード時間などに使うとよいらしい…
数値ではなくtrueを設置した場合は直帰扱いになるらしい…
aタグにtarget=”_blank”を設定していたらtrue設定は意味はなさそうだけど…よく分かんないです。

実際に試したレポート結果

イベントトラッキングを試すものが見つからなかったのですが、アフィリエイトも出来るのかな?と思い特に意味はないですがアフィリエイトで試してみました。

アフィリエイトA8バージョン

<a href="リンク先URL" target="_blank" onClick="ga('send', 'event', 'affiliate', 'click', 'A8');>画像</a>

試した結果、ちゃんと計測できました!
イベントのレポートは、Googleアナリティクスにログインして左側にある「行動 > イベント」から確認できます。

▼ 行動 > イベント > サマリー

トラッキングで指定した「カテゴリ、アクション、ラベル」は、「行動 > イベント > 上位のイベント」にあるプライマリ ディメンションで切り替えて各データが確認できるようです。

▼ 行動 > イベント > 上位のイベント > イベント カテゴリ

▼ 行動 > イベント > 上位のイベント > イベント アクション

▼ 行動 > イベント > 上位のイベント > イベント ラベル

注意点

前回の「WordPress管理者のアクセスをカウントさせない方法」などの対策をしている場合は、ちゃんとイベントトラッキングをクリックする時にGoogleAnalyticsコードが出力されているか確認して下さい。 GoogleAnalyticsコードが出力されていないと幾らクリックしてもレポートに反映されないので注意して下さい。 自分は、最初気づかず1日無駄にしました…

【参考Webサイト】

モバイルバージョンを終了